Hsinchu Air Base 2019
report by: Thierry Letellier As of the late 1990s, the longest runway at Hsinchu was reportedly 12,000 feet long. After opening the Sungshan, Shuinan, Chiayi, Tainan, Pingtung, Fengnien, Hualien, Makung, and Kinmen military airports for civil aviation, MND also opened the Hsinchu military airport from 01 January 1998. AAD 2018 – Waterkloof AFB
report by: Thierry Letellier Waterkloof is the South African Air Force’s (SAAF) busiest air force base (AFB). It is located in the town of Centurion in Gauteng Province.
